• Home
  • Chemistry
  • Astronomy
  • Energy
  • Nature
  • Biology
  • Physics
  • Electronics
  • The Intertwined Relationship Between Computer Science and Physics
    Computer science and physics might seem like distinct fields, but they have a surprisingly deep and intertwined relationship. Here's how:

    1. Computing Power for Physics:

    * Simulations and Modeling: Physics relies heavily on computer simulations to understand complex phenomena. From astrophysical events to molecular interactions, computers are used to model and predict outcomes that are impossible or too expensive to test physically. This requires powerful algorithms and computational techniques developed within computer science.

    * Data Analysis: Experiments in physics generate vast amounts of data. Computer science provides the tools and techniques for analyzing, visualizing, and extracting meaningful insights from this data. Machine learning and statistical analysis play a crucial role in understanding patterns and making new discoveries.

    * High-Performance Computing: Solving complex physics problems often requires massive computational power. Computer science has developed advanced hardware and software architectures, like supercomputers and parallel processing techniques, to handle these computational demands.

    2. Physics Inspiring Computer Science:

    * Quantum Computing: Quantum mechanics, a fundamental theory in physics, has inspired the development of quantum computers. These machines harness the principles of quantum superposition and entanglement to solve certain types of problems exponentially faster than classical computers.

    * Nanotechnology: Physics research on nanoscale materials has driven advancements in computer hardware. For example, understanding electron transport in transistors has led to smaller, faster, and more energy-efficient processors.

    * Information Theory: Concepts from statistical physics, particularly the study of entropy, have contributed to the development of information theory. This field deals with the quantification and transmission of information, which is crucial for computer communication and storage.

    3. Common Ground:

    * Algorithms: Computer science and physics both rely on algorithms to solve problems. Optimization algorithms, for example, are used in both fields to find the best solutions within constraints.

    * Modeling and Abstraction: Both fields rely on abstract models to represent complex systems. Computer scientists use models to understand software, while physicists use them to describe physical phenomena.

    * Data Structures: The efficient organization and manipulation of data is essential in both fields. Computer science develops data structures like trees, graphs, and lists, while physics uses them to represent physical systems and analyze data.

    Examples of Intersection:

    * Astrophysics: Computers are used to simulate black hole mergers, galaxy formation, and the evolution of the universe.

    * Materials Science: Simulations help predict the properties of new materials with desired characteristics, such as strength, conductivity, or optical properties.

    * Biophysics: Computational methods are used to study protein folding, drug interactions, and the dynamics of biological systems.

    In conclusion, computer science and physics are deeply interconnected, each benefiting from the advances and insights of the other. This collaboration is driving innovation and accelerating progress in both fields.

    Science Discoveries © www.scienceaq.com